Instructions
Let’s dive into the steps to create this flavorful masterpiece:
Preheat Your Oven: Start by preheating your oven to 400°F. This ensures your pizzas cook evenly and get that perfect golden crust.
Prepare the Toast: Lay out your garlic Texas toast slices on a baking sheet. This is your canvas, so make sure they’re evenly spaced.
Add the Sauce: Spread a generous layer of pizza sauce over each slice. Don’t be shy this is where the flavor starts!
Layer the Cheese: Sprinkle a hearty amount of shredded mozzarella over the sauce. This is what gives your pizzas that irresistible cheesy pull.
Top It Off: Add your favorite toppings. Whether you’re a pepperoni purist or a veggie lover, this is your chance to customize.
Bake to Perfection: Pop the baking sheet into the oven and bake for 10-12 minutes, or until the cheese is bubbly and the edges are golden brown.
Finishing Touches: Remove from the oven and let cool for a minute or two. Sprinkle with Italian seasoning or fresh herbs for that final touch of flavor.
Serve and Enjoy: Serve warm and enjoy! These mini pizzas are perfect as a snack, appetizer, or even a main dish paired with a fresh salad.

FAQ Section
- Can I substitute pizza sauce with marinara sauce?
Absolutely! Marinara sauce works just as well and adds a slightly different flavor profile. - Can I make this dish ahead of time?
Yes, it’s a great make-ahead recipe. Prepare the pizzas up to the baking step, cover, and refrigerate. Bake just before serving. - How do I store leftovers?
Store leftovers in an airtight container in the refrigerator for up to 2 days. Reheat in the oven for best results. - Can I freeze this dish?
Yes! Assemble the pizzas, wrap them tightly, and freeze for up to 1 month. Bake directly from frozen, adding a few extra minutes to the cooking time. - What’s the best way to reheat this dish?
Reheat in the oven at 350°F for 5-7 minutes or in the microwave in 30-second intervals until warmed through. - Can I use different types of cheese?
Definitely! Try a mix of mozzarella, cheddar, or even provolone for a unique flavor. - Is this recipe kid-friendly?
Absolutely! Kids love the mini pizza format, and you can let them customize their own toppings. - Can I make this gluten-free?
Yes, simply use gluten-free Texas toast or bread as the base. - What other toppings can I use?
Get creative! Try cooked sausage, caramelized onions, or even pineapple for a sweet and savory twist. - Can I use fresh garlic instead of garlic toast?
Yes, you can use regular bread and add a layer of garlic butter for a similar flavor.

Garlic Texas Toast Pizzas: A Flavorful Twist on a Classic Comfort Food
- Prep Time: 5 minutes
- Cook Time: 15 minutes
- Total Time: 20 minutes
- Yield: 8 mini pizzas 1x
- Category: Appetizer / Main Course
- Method: Baking
- Cuisine: American
- Diet: Gluten Free
Description
These quick and easy Garlic Texas Toast Pizzas are the perfect weeknight dinner or fun snack! Toasted garlic bread is topped with pizza sauce, Italian sausage, melted mozzarella, and pepperoni for a delicious twist on classic pizza. Ready in under 20 minutes!
Ingredients
1/2 lb Italian sausage
1 box frozen garlic Texas Toast (8 slices)
14 oz jar pizza sauce (slightly warmed, divided use)
1 cup shredded mozzarella cheese (more or less to taste)
24 pepperoni slices
1 tbsp dried parsley (optional)
1 tsp red pepper flakes (optional)
Instructions
- Cook the Sausage:
- Cook and crumble the Italian sausage in a skillet over medium heat. Drain any excess grease and set aside.
- Prepare the Texas Toast:
- Preheat the oven to the temperature specified on the Texas Toast box.
- Place the Texas Toast slices on a parchment paper-lined baking sheet.
- Cook the toast according to the package directions, flipping halfway through to toast both sides (about 7-9 minutes). Remove from the oven.
- Assemble the Pizzas:
- Spread about 1 tbsp of warmed pizza sauce on each slice of toasted garlic bread.
- Sprinkle the cooked sausage evenly over the sauce.
- Top with shredded mozzarella cheese (divided evenly among the slices).
- Add 3 pepperoni slices to each pizza.
- Bake:
- Return the baking sheet to the oven and bake for 3-5 minutes, or until the cheese is melted and bubbly.
- Garnish and Serve:
- Remove from the oven and sprinkle with dried parsley and red pepper flakes (optional).
- Serve with the remaining warmed pizza sauce for dipping.
Notes
Substitute ground beef, turkey, or plant-based sausage for the Italian sausage.
Add your favorite toppings like mushrooms, olives, or bell peppers.
For a spicier kick, use spicy Italian sausage or add extra red pepper flakes.
